We present a study on the synthesis, characterization and application of sodium carbonate tag silica-coated nano-Fe 3 O 4 (Fe 3 O 4 @SiO 2 @(CH 2 ) 3 OCO 2 Na) as a novel and efficient heterogeneous basic catalyst. The described catalyst was fully characterized via FT-IR, X-ray diffraction (XRD), energy dispersive X-ray spectroscopy (EDS), and field emission scanning electron microscopy (FE-SEM). The reported novel magnetic nanocatalyst presents an excellent activity and catalytic performance for the synthesis of a novel series of pyranocoumarins through the reaction of dialkyl acetylenedicarboxylates and 5,7-dihydroxy coumarin derivatives at 100 C under solvent-free conditions.
